Weather Cancels Bansko Super G

After a morning of delays, the Audi FIS Ski World Cup super G in Bansko, Bulgaria was canceled due to weather.
Already rescheduled from the Bad Kleinkirchheim cancelation earlier this season, Friday's super G was supposed to start at 5:00 a.m. EST. But with 10-15 inches of fresh heavy snow overnight, the race was pushed in order to clear the track. However, once the course crew shoveled the snow off the course, a thick fog settled over the hill. Rowdy Bulgarian fans stuck around, cheering and playing with noisemakers until 7:30 a.m. EST, when the race organizers finally called it.
